Dave Kreskowiak wrote:
that's because it's the limit in Windows, not .NET. The current path limit is 248 characters and the filename limit is 260.


But there are easy ways to accidentally create pathnames much much longer than that. When I try the FileInfo class, I run into that barrier. FindFirstFileEx() allows me to get around that problem. I have that working fine. But the Unicode part of it is what is biting me.

Incidentally, I also found through tests that the TRUE limit for Windows, is 240 characters max. When you subtract the 8.3name from the 260 and get 248, you still have to remove another 3 for the root folder...That leaves you with 245, but then you cannot use another 5 characters. This may be a bug in Windows, but in some cases, if you try to go beyond 240, you can open/save a file OK, even move it or change its name, but you may not be able to right-click it without crashing Windows and forcing it to restart. Fortunately, you do not lose any of your running apps, but all the desktop windows you had open, get closed.
